Location: This occurrence is located at an elevation of 4,250 feet northeast of upper Ann Creek. It is in the NE1/4NW1/4 section 21, T. 18 S., R. 10 E., Fairbanks Meridian.
Geology: This occurrence consists of massive sulfide-bearing float boulders as much as 1.5 feet in diameter (W.T. Ellis, oral communication, 2001). The boulders contain 60 to 70 percent massive pyrrhotite and subordinate amounts of pyrite and chalcopyrite. The float is on a slope just below a serpentinized Upper Triassic ultramafic sill that intrudes the Slana Spur Formation of Pennsylvanian age (W.T. Ellis, oral communication, 2001).
Workings: Samples of the massive sulfide contained 1.8 percent copper and 12.8 ppm silver (W.T. Ellis, oral communication, 2001). The occurrence is on active claims of MAN Resources.
Age: Late Triassic or younger.
Alteration: The ultramafic rocks are extensively serpentinized.
Commodities (Major) - Ag, Cu
Development Status: No
Deposit Model: Cu skarn (?) (Cox and Singer, 1986; model 18b).
